Fair Market Rent Comparison — HUD 2025 Data

Quick Answer

Springfield is 9% cheaper for renters. A 2-bedroom rents for $756/mo vs $821/mo in Killeen-Temple — saving $780/year.

Rent by Unit Size

Unit SizeKilleen-TempleSpringfieldDifference
Studio$537$519$18
1 Bedroom$671$612$59
2 Bedrooms$821$756$65
3 Bedrooms$1,031$923$108
4 Bedrooms$1,205$1,067$138
Median Income$41,045$44,958$3,913
